Toni Kroos should be given more freedom to join the Real Madrid attack in the absence of his injured team-mate James Rodriguez.
Rodriguez has enjoyed a very solid first season at the Bernabeu following his big-money move from Monaco last summer. Per WhoScored.com, he has accumulated nine goals and eight assists in league and Champions League play.
Despite largely playing in a deeper role than that to which he was previously accustomed, the 23-year-old has made a direct contribution to a goal every 111 minutes.
